Allyson Felix
Allyson Felix was deemed to be one of the most talented track athletes in today’s generation. Allyson Felix had contended and was a part of Team USA from the year 2004 until the year 2016. Allyson became the only female track athlete in history who had brought home six gold medals in addition to the other three silver medals she had also won. Although Allyson Felix had made a name and had established herself worldwide, she was very keen to keep her personal life private. There was a picture of her that was shot at the 2018 Laureus World Sports Awards.